Handover Note — Heads of Department

From: Director Maren Olsk
To: Director Tibo Rell

Pellwright supplier contract expires in nine weeks. Renewal draft is in the shared folder; pricing clause still open. Pellwright wants a three-year term; we want two with an exit option. Legal has flagged the indemnity wording — push back. Next call is scheduled for the 14th; brief Rasha beforehand. Keep volume commitments soft until the new forecast lands. The reason we're holding firm is set out below.

management briefing: Project Ulavan slips by two quarters because of the staffing delay.

- [ ] Step 7: Archive cold storage buckets (Glacierline tier). Confirm both ceremony witnesses are present, verify bucket manifests match the Oxbow ledger, then seal the archive key shares. Plugin authors may observe but not handle shares. Once sealed, the archive index itself is encrypted and can only be reopened with the passphrase below.

vault phrase of badup-hahig = tamael-aldael-kelmir-istael-fenok-istwyn-tamius-jorath-oliion

## Onboarding — FX Rounding (Quartermint)

Quartermint converts currency in integer minor units. Never use floats. Historical bug: the rate fetcher rounded before multiplication, losing up to 0.4% on small amounts; fixed in v2.3 by rounding only at display time. Review any PR touching `fx/convert` for reintroduced float math. Local setup: the converter reads `QM_ROUNDING=half_even` from the env file and refuses to start without it. Set that flag, then add the rate-feed access secret on the next line:

vault entry, yahif-yajep: COURIER_KEY29=b802bdf8034096b65a51c6ba5abe2

## Monthly partitions — quick notes

The Ledgerbird tables roll over to a new partition on the first of each month. If the rollover job stalls, inserts start failing loudly, so check the partition creator first before anything else. Run the manual creator script only with the settings shown here.

deployment values, hahaf-fahop:
zorwyn:
  log_level: debug
  metrics_host: metrics.zorwyn.tolvaqlabs.internal
  pool_size: 8